You must use the Prefer: include-unknown-enum-members request header to get the following values in this evolvable enum: invited, … WebFeb 26, 2024 · An autologous bypass graft looks just like a normal, healthy vessel on two-dimensional and color flow ultrasound images. It can be identified by its pulsating color and location down the length of the medial thigh. Some surgeons tend to place the graft in the native artery’s anatomical location—which can be confusing at first.

WebFeb 11, 2024 · The evidence in our review is current until 13 March 2024. From our analysis, we found that grafts made from a person's own vein had a better primary patency (blood flow) rate than the prosthetic materials PTFE or Dacron for above-knee bypass grafts. Meanwhile, Dacron (and possibly also human umbilical vein) achieved better blood flow …
